**Job Overview**

We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Graduate / Trainee Accountant to join our team in Castledermot, Co. Kildare.

The successful candidate will be responsible for preparing weekly and monthly reports, ensuring timely reconciliations, managing stock levels, and performing ad-hoc tasks as required.

This is an excellent opportunity for someone looking to develop their skills in accounting and gain experience working with NetSuite.

**Key Responsibilities**
  • Preparation of weekly and monthly financial reports.
  • Perform monthly reconciliations in a timely manner.
  • Manage inventory levels and movements.
  • Assist with ad-hoc reports and tasks as required.
  • Work collaboratively with the finance team to achieve key targets.
**The Ideal Candidate**

We are looking for someone who is self-motivated, has high-level attention to detail, and is able to work effectively in a team environment.

A good knowledge of Excel is essential, and experience with NetSuite would be a distinct advantage.
